Ok so I'm from Miami, and have watched Wallace since he was on the Steelers. This is my take (FWIW):

Wallace is a talented receiver. He is blisteringly fast. He has good hands, body placement, the works. What he also has is a bit of an attitude. This could be a huge pickup for our Vikings should he play like he did in Pit. I also think it wasn't completely his fault in Miami for his lackluster performance. Tannehill was still quite inconsistent, and the Dolphins did not have much of an identity. I really believe that Wallace can do very good things for us, and he will fit in admirably in Turner's system.

I will say that his salary should be restructured considering, at the moment he is not worth nearly that much. And also consider how much we are paying Jennings. What helps with this trade, and the cap hit is the fact that most of our players are young with small contacts, so I think we can keep Wallace's salary for the year, and if he plays well, resign him long term.

Anyways, just my two cents.
